Output 73add8ebca1340c8bfbc657a3fbbbc18b0bb1a4e75df36cc74f540a3291a2905:1

value
271887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cef6ff3bac3da46eec293fd3d006ef143705e188 OP_EQUAL
address
3LZM1iLcFjrFRuvV3nfPpu7VpMrm8nwzUf
transaction
73add8ebca1340c8bfbc657a3fbbbc18b0bb1a4e75df36cc74f540a3291a2905
confirmations
245351
spent
true